摘要
For the ferrimagnetic compound ErCo3 (T-C = 401 K), a temperature-induced magnetic transition in the Co-sublattices near 100K was reported previously. The Co-moments of two of the three non-equivalent Co-sites increase discontinuously upon cooling below this transition temperature. Here, we report on the investigation of this metamagnetic transition when the molecular field is reduced, partly substituting Er by Y. Neutron-diffraction experiments on Er1-xYxCo3 compounds reveal that this temperature-induced magnetic transition vanishes for x >= 0.3. As new phenomenon, a spin-reorientation out of the c-axis is observednear 40K when Er is partly replaced by Y. Both phenomena are studied by neutron and NMR experiments. (C) 2004 Elsevier B.V.
